Wallington Station Bridge Repainted

A photo taken on Valentine’s Day by Cllr. Hamish Pollock of the latest state of redecoration of the railway bridge at Wallington Station, Woodcote Road. 

We assume that the final colour is on the right – is it called “Lincoln green”? For many years this bridge has carried a red/orange-coloured advert on both sides for an Estate Agents that has faded away in the sunlight and thus made this prominent corner of Wallington town centre look just a little bit shabby! The redecoration works are taking place after a campaign by the local Lib Dem councillors for Wallington South.
